Winter Weekend

February 25th & 26th, 2012

at

The Ashokan Center
Olivebridge, NY

 

For almost two decades, Ashokan (with the help of NYSOEA) has hosted this annual gathering for outdoor educators resulting in friendships and education experiences that have spanned the years.  Now, for the first time, it is entirely in the hands of NYSOEA to keep it going for the future.
